Title: O2 sensor location
Post by: rc2325 on 13 March 2011, 12:06:03
Can anyone point me in the right direction for locating the O2 sensor (Bank 1 Sensor 2)  [smiley=embarassed.gif]
Been getting low voltage/range/performance faults.  :'(
 
Its on a petrol 2.2 auto.

Thanks

Ricky
Title: Re: O2 sensor location
Post by: ndmv6 on 13 March 2011, 12:12:40
hello,there are 2 on the 2.2.1 is on the downpipe near the exhaust manifold,the other is in the middle of the exhaust system near the cat..i changed the one by the cat,part number 9202576(for auto 2.2 petrol)and this cured the eml light coming back on...
Title: Re: O2 sensor location
Post by: RobG on 13 March 2011, 12:12:47
After the pre-cat, before pre-cat is sensor 1
